Cultivating Productivity through Regulation: The Case of Pesticide Bans in France

Latin Quarter

Think pesticide bans hurt farming? This economics talk makes the counterintuitive case that regulation can actually boost productivity. Join researcher Simon Bunel for a sharp, data-driven argument about green policy and innovation at France's most prestigious academic institution.
